Shaftesbury has today announced that 6 new food and beverage brands have actually signed or are set to sign up with, the Seven Dials community: WatchHouse, ANITA, and a debut London flagship dining establishment from Aspirational Brands take space on upper St Martins Lane, whilst Chai Guys, From The Ashes BBQ, and Longboys join the line-up of traders in Seven Dials Market. Amounting to over 8,000 sq ft, each operator includes an unique dimension to Seven Dials varied F&B offering, solidifying it as the West Ends go-to dining location for the cooking curious.
Set to be exposed in March, Aspirational Brands has picked Upper St Martins Lane for their first flagship modern British themed dining establishment in London. This brand-new principle, the name yet to be revealed, will provide a substantial all-day dining menu, combined with a large selection of fine wines, spirits and expertly crafted botanical mixed drinks. From premium bar bites to elevated gastro options, the new idea will span three floors, overall just over 5,000 sq ft and have a dedicated al fresco dining location, adding to Seven Dials all-day, all-season dining establishment offering.
Adding to the line-up on St Martins Lane at the end of April, is the UK launching for shop ice cream parlour, ANITA. With Mediterranean origins and being renowned for its homemade and natural variety, ANITA will serve over 150 different flavours of rejuvenating ice cream, sorbet, and frozen yoghurts, with natural sugar-free, vegan, and soy-based varieties. The 1,000 sq feet area likewise offers sweet toppings and newly baked waffles, offering visitors with a truly distinct gelateria experience.
Modern coffee pioneer, WatchHouse, which opened a two-floor, 1,900 sq ft coffee and brunch location on St Martins Lane last month, encompasses the brands Modern Coffee experience and serves as an advanced yet comfortable retreat. Developed in-house with the help of Deidra Hodgson, the site also includes a bespoke retail location for coffee and brew kits, designed to provide a engaging and integrated visitor experience.

Hanover Green Retail and Shelley Sandzer represented Seven Dials. Dining establishment Property acted upon behalf of Aspirational Brands on the offer.

Chai Guys, the Indian inspired brand which brews and serves authentic chai all day long, as well as newly baked goods, has now opened in Seven Dials Market.
British bbq and smoked meat operator, From The Ashes BBQ, founded by three chefs during the very first lockdown, serve a range of flavourful foods varying from low smoked pork shoulder, to meaty beef ribs.
Set up in 2019 by distinguished pastry chefs Graham Hornigold and Heather Kaniuk, small-batch doughnut bakeshop, Longboys, specialise in handmade finger doughnuts with the objective of making high-end patisserie accessible to all. The ever-changing menu boasts special flavours consisting of Lemon Meringue Pie, Raspberry Rose Lychee and Apple Crumble.
